当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储开源软件下载,深入解析对象存储开源软件,下载与使用指南

对象存储开源软件下载,深入解析对象存储开源软件,下载与使用指南

本指南深入解析对象存储开源软件,提供下载与使用方法,助您轻松掌握对象存储技术。涵盖软件特点、安装步骤、配置技巧,助您高效管理海量数据。...

本指南深入解析对象存储开源软件,提供下载与使用方法,助您轻松掌握对象存储技术。涵盖软件特点、安装步骤、配置技巧,助您高效管理海量数据。

随着互联网的飞速发展,数据量呈爆炸式增长,传统的存储方式已无法满足需求,对象存储作为一种新型的存储技术,以其分布式、可扩展、高可靠等特点,逐渐成为企业存储的首选,本文将为您详细介绍一款优秀的对象存储开源软件——OpenStack Swift,并指导您如何下载和使用。

OpenStack Swift简介

OpenStack Swift是一款开源的对象存储系统,由Rackspace和NASA共同开发,它具有以下特点:

对象存储开源软件下载,深入解析对象存储开源软件,下载与使用指南

1、分布式存储:Swift将数据分散存储在多个节点上,提高了系统的可靠性和可用性。

2、可扩展性:Swift支持水平扩展,可以根据需求增加节点数量。

3、高可靠性:Swift采用冗余存储策略,确保数据不会因单个节点的故障而丢失。

4、高性能:Swift支持大规模并发访问,满足高性能需求。

5、兼容性:Swift遵循S3 API规范,与市面上大多数云存储服务兼容。

下载OpenStack Swift

1、访问OpenStack Swift官网(https://www.openstack.org/software/swift/)。

2、在官网首页,点击“Download”按钮。

3、在弹出的页面中,选择合适的版本(最新稳定版)。

4、下载完成后,解压压缩包。

安装OpenStack Swift

1、安装Python环境:由于Swift是基于Python开发的,因此需要安装Python环境,在官网上可以找到Python的安装教程。

对象存储开源软件下载,深入解析对象存储开源软件,下载与使用指南

2、安装依赖库:根据您的操作系统,安装相应的依赖库,以下以CentOS为例:

a. 安装pip:sudo yum install python-pip

b. 安装依赖库:pip install -r requirements.txt

3、安装OpenStack Swift:sudo pip install swift

4、配置OpenStack Swift:

a. 编辑/etc/swift/swift.conf文件,配置存储节点信息。

b. 编辑/etc/swift/proxy-server.conf文件,配置代理服务器信息。

c. 编辑/etc/swift/object-server.conf文件,配置对象存储节点信息。

5、启动OpenStack Swift服务:

a. 启动代理服务器:swift-proxy-server

对象存储开源软件下载,深入解析对象存储开源软件,下载与使用指南

b. 启动对象存储节点:swift-object-server

使用OpenStack Swift

1、创建容器:在命令行中输入以下命令创建一个名为“test”的容器:

   swift create test

2、上传文件:将本地文件上传到容器中:

   swift upload test example.txt

3、下载文件:从容器中下载文件:

   swift download test example.txt

4、删除文件:从容器中删除文件:

   swift delete test example.txt

5、查看容器信息:查看容器中存储的文件:

   swift list test

OpenStack Swift是一款功能强大的对象存储开源软件,具有分布式、可扩展、高可靠等特点,通过本文的介绍,您应该已经掌握了如何下载、安装和使用OpenStack Swift,希望本文能对您有所帮助。

黑狐家游戏

发表评论

最新文章